The fastest way to see your system specs

Open the Settings app by pressing the Windows key and typing "settings", then click the result. Go to System in the left menu, then click About. You will see your processor, RAM, system type, and Windows version all on one screen. This is the quickest route if you just need the basics.

If Settings does not open or you prefer a different method, right-click This PC on your desktop or in File Explorer and select Properties. The same information appears in a single window. Both methods take about 10 seconds and show you what you need to know about your hardware.

What each spec means and why you need it

Your processor (CPU) is the brain of your computer. The name tells you the brand (Intel or AMD) and generation — an Intel Core i7-10th gen is older than an i7-12th gen. More cores and higher clock speed (measured in GHz) mean faster performance, but the generation matters more than the raw number.

Your RAM (memory) is how much space your computer has to work on tasks right now. 8 GB is the minimum for everyday use; 16 GB handles heavy multitasking, photo editing, or gaming. If you have less than 8 GB and your computer feels slow, upgrading RAM is often the cheapest fix.

Your storage is how much space you have for files and programs. This is different from RAM — storage is permanent, RAM is temporary. Windows 10 itself takes about 20 GB, so a 256 GB drive fills up quickly if you store photos or videos. If you are running out of space, your computer will slow down noticeably.

Your system type tells you whether you have a 64-bit or 32-bit operating system. Almost all modern computers run 64-bit, which can use more RAM and run newer software. If you see 32-bit, you are limited to about 4 GB of RAM and many programs will not install.

Finding your graphics card and other components

The About screen does not show your graphics card, sound card, or network adapter. To see those, open Device Manager by pressing the Windows key and typing "device manager", then click the result. Expand the categories by clicking the arrows — your graphics card is under Display adapters, your sound card is under Sound, video and game controllers, and your network adapter is under Network adapters.

Right-click any device and select Properties to see its driver version and date. If a device has a yellow warning triangle, the driver is outdated or missing. You can update drivers through Device Manager by right-clicking the device and selecting Update driver, though Windows Update usually handles this automatically.

Using DirectX Diagnostic Tool for detailed hardware information

Press the Windows key and type "dxdiag", then click the result. This opens the DirectX Diagnostic Tool, which shows detailed specs for your graphics, sound, and storage. The System tab repeats your processor and RAM. The Display tab shows your graphics card, how much video memory it has, and its driver version.

The Sound tab lists your audio devices and drivers. The Storage tab shows each drive, how much space is used, and how much is free. At the bottom of the window, you can click Run 64-Bit Diagnostics or Run 32-Bit Diagnostics to test your hardware for problems — this takes a few minutes and reports any failures.

Checking real-time performance with Task Manager

Press Ctrl + Shift + Esc to open Task Manager directly, or press Ctrl + Alt + Delete and click Task Manager. Click the Performance tab to see live graphs of your CPU, RAM, disk, and network usage. This shows you what is actually happening right now, not just what you have installed.

If your computer feels slow, watch the Performance tab while you use it. If CPU usage stays near 100%, a program is working too hard — look at the Processes tab to see which one. If RAM is nearly full, you need more memory or need to close some programs. If disk usage spikes to 100%, Windows is reading or writing files heavily, which slows everything down.

Understanding Windows version and build number

Windows 10 receives updates regularly, and each update has a version number and build number. In Settings > System > About, you will see Version (like 22H2) and OS Build (like 19045.xxxx). The version number tells you which major update you are on; the build number is more specific.

You do not need to memorize these numbers, but they matter when you are troubleshooting. If a program does not work, the support page might say "requires Windows 10 version 21H2 or later" — you can check your version here to see if you need to update. Windows Update usually installs new versions automatically, but you can check manually by going to Settings > Update & Security > Check for updates.

What to do if a spec is missing or shows as unknown

If Device Manager shows a device as "Unknown device" or with a question mark, the driver is missing or corrupted. Right-click it and select Update driver, then choose Search automatically for updated driver software. Windows will search online and install the correct driver if it finds one.

If a device still shows as unknown after updating, you may need to find the driver manually. Go to the manufacturer's website (Dell, HP, Lenovo, Asus, etc.), find your computer model, and read the driver from their support page. Install it, then restart your computer. If you still cannot identify a device, take a photo of the Device Manager entry and search for the hardware ID online — someone else has likely identified it.

Frequently Asked Questions

How much RAM do I actually need?

Eight gigabytes is enough for web browsing, email, and office work. Sixteen gigabytes handles photo editing, video streaming, and gaming without slowdowns. Thirty-two gigabytes is overkill unless you work with large video files or run virtual machines. Check your RAM usage in Task Manager while doing your normal work — if it stays below 80%, you have enough.

What does "64-bit" mean and why does it matter?

A 64-bit system can use more than 4 GB of RAM and run newer software. Almost all modern computers are 64-bit. If you have 32-bit Windows, you are limited to about 4 GB of RAM no matter how much you install, and many programs will not run. You can upgrade to 64-bit Windows 10, but you will lose your programs and files in the process.

My storage says I have 256 GB but Windows only shows 230 GB available. Where did the rest go?

Manufacturers measure storage in decimal gigabytes (1,000 MB = 1 GB), but Windows measures in binary gigabytes (1,024 MB = 1 GB). The difference adds up — 256 GB becomes about 238 GB in Windows. Windows 10 itself also takes about 20 GB, so 238 minus 20 leaves roughly 218 GB for your files and programs.

Can I upgrade my processor or graphics card?

Processors are soldered to the motherboard in most laptops and cannot be upgraded. In desktop computers, you can replace the processor if you have the right motherboard and power supply, but it is technical work. Graphics cards can be upgraded in most desktops by inserting a new card into a slot, though you need a power supply with enough capacity. Check your computer's manual or manufacturer website before buying parts.

Why does my computer show less RAM than I installed?

If you installed 16 GB but Windows shows 15 GB, some RAM is reserved for the graphics card or system use — this is normal. If you installed 16 GB but Windows shows 8 GB, one stick may not be seated properly. Shut down, open the case, remove and reseat both RAM sticks firmly, then restart. If it still shows 8 GB, one stick may be faulty.
